This a prodigious young PN that blossomed after a couple hours in the decanter. Still very primary. Cherry and cedar dominant with significant depth. If you can resist hold for a couple years.

First time I had this wine a couple years ago it was an “ah-ha” moment of what California pinot noir could be. Structure, length, lift. A revisit today is a hair less compelling with a slightly green note on the finish. But nonetheless it is a wine that should last a while and I’m excited to follow over the next decade
